E-Waste Management in the Medical Industry – KD Hospital’s Sustainable Approach
Client Background

KD Hospital, a renowned medical institution in Ahmedabad, is known for its advanced healthcare services and cutting-edge medical equipment. The hospital faced an increasing amount of e-waste from outdated devices, including MRI machines and other high-tech medical equipment.

Challenges
  1. E-Waste Accumulation: The hospital needed to dispose of 100+ sensors from MRI machines and over 500 kg of e-waste safely and sustainably.
  2. Material Recovery: Identifying and recycling valuable metals used in the sensors was essential to minimize environmental impact.
  3. Regulatory Compliance: Ensuring the safe handling and disposal of medical e-waste in line with environmental regulations.
Solution Delivered

ECS Environment provided a comprehensive e-waste management solution:

  • Conducted detailed e-waste collection and safely transported it for recycling.
  • Performed an in-depth material analysis of the sensors to recover valuable metals such as copper, gold, platinum, and rare earth elements.
  • Ensured compliance with environmental regulations throughout the process, with a focus on sustainability.
Results
  • E-Waste Collected: Successfully collected and processed 500+ kg of e-waste, including over 100 sensors from MRI machines and other medical devices.
  • Material Recovery: Conducted an in-depth material analysis, recovering valuable metals such as copper, gold, platinum, and rare earth elements, contributing to resource sustainability.
  • Regulatory Compliance: Ensured adherence to environmental regulations, minimizing the ecological impact associated with e-waste disposal in Ahmedabad.
  • Sustainability Leadership: KD Hospital demonstrated a commitment to sustainable practices, setting a benchmark for other healthcare institutions in the region.

Secure Data Sanitization and IT Asset Disposal for HHA Exchange: A Comprehensive Case Study
Client Overview

HHA Exchange, a prominent US-based service provider with an extensive operations department in India, needed to decommission 372 IT assets. Given the sensitive nature of their operations, they required a reliable partner to ensure secure data sanitization and asset disposal.

Client Requirement

Our client came directly to seek our services from their headquarter in the United States of America with clear specifications as follows:

  • Data Sanitization: Data destruction to the level where none of the data can be recovered in any form.
  • Hard Disk (HDD) Destruction: Formatting or shredding of computer discs, or complete disposal of them.
  • Full IT Asset Destruction: Disposal of all IT assets particularly SSDs local memory cards and any other storage medias without compromising on safety.
Our Solution

As the security of the client’s work was considered as one of the highest priorities, eradicating the threat of information leakage and unauthorized access, we developed a complex and strict procedure for the elimination of all kinds of data and IT products using data sanitization:

  • HDD Destruction: We used a particular magnet tool to demagnetize the hard disks and indeed expunge the memory of all their data. This method is one of the most effective methods of data sanitization, which guarantees that it is impossible to recover data.
  • SSD Destruction: Again, because of the difference in storage technology, we suggested that the SSDs be sliced into 2mm thick slivers. This approach is a very accurate approach of data elimination, which doesn’t allow recovery of the stored data since the storage cells are erased.
  • Proof of Destruction: Strikingly, we were able to capture through videos and photographs all the destruction that was being done on the building. This information was made available to the client to ensure that all data sanitization services and destruction processes where done as the client requested.
  • On-site Processing: Each machine, laptop, and every storage device was sealed and transported safely to the client’s office where the destruction process had to start. Special care was taken to properly handle each of the assets so that when destroyed, it was properly sanitized following best practices.
Results

The entire data sanitization and destruction process was completed with precision, meeting all of HHA Exchange’s requirements. The client received comprehensive proof of destruction, ensuring peace of mind that their sensitive data was securely erased and their IT assets were properly disposed of.
